Search
Sign Up
Help
Blog
News
Sign In
Aezion Inc
Add Contact
Send Message
Send E-Card
Aezion Inc
Bookmarks
(8)
Aezion Inc. | Mobile Application Development in Dallas, TX
www.aezion.com/mobile-ap ...
Location:
Dallas
,
Texas
,
United States
255 views since 18 April 2018
©2007-2019 Billion 7 International, Inc. All Rights Reserved